www.cdc.govThe period 1900 through 1909 was the deadliest decade in U.S. underground coal mining, and led to the legislation that founded the Bureau of Mines with the express mandate of reducing fatalities in the mining industry. From 1900 through 1909, 3,660 miners perished in a total of 133 mine disasters. Sixteen major mine disasters during

sha.org#213 over a<> Heinz Glasshouse (1900-1943) #255 Owen-Illinois Mr. Heinz founded the company in 1869. In 1875 he sold his company to his brother John and cousin Frederick. They called their company F&J Heinz, using the initials from their first names. The eventually sold the companies back to HJ in 1888 and the name became H.J. Heinz.

files.eric.ed.govIn 1920, the American Association of Junior Colleges (AAJC) was founded, at a critical time in the evolution of junior colleges. Today, this organization is the American Association of Community Colleges and is the national organization for community colleges in America. www.archives.govSouth Carolina, for instance, was essentially founded in the late 1600s as a mainland extension of the British colony of Barbados when slaveholding families moved to North America to acquire land for new plantations. hose families initially brought their enslaved property with them and imported others from the West Indies.
